The FlowOrchestrator maintainers take security seriously. This document explains how to report a vulnerability and what you can expect in return.
We provide security fixes for the latest minor release on the 1.x line. Older minor versions receive fixes only when the issue is critical and a back-port is straightforward.

If you depend on a version no longer supported, the recommended action is to upgrade to the current minor — patch releases are non-breaking by SemVer.
Please do not open a public GitHub issue for security problems.
Use one of the following private channels:
-
GitHub Private Vulnerability Reporting (preferred) Open an advisory at https://github.com/hoangsnowy/FlowOrchestrator/security/advisories/new. GitHub notifies the maintainers privately and gives us a coordinated workspace to triage, draft a fix, and request a CVE.
-
Email If you cannot use the GitHub UI, email nguyenminhhoang.dit12@gmail.com with the subject line
[SECURITY] FlowOrchestrator — <short description>.
Encrypted communication is available on request — reply to the acknowledgement email and we will exchange a public key.
To help us triage quickly, please provide:
- A clear description of the issue and the impact (data exposure, RCE, auth bypass, DoS, etc.).
- The affected version(s) and the platform / runtime where you reproduced it.
- A minimal reproduction — code snippet, manifest, HTTP request, or failing test.
- Any proof-of-concept or exploit script (kept private; we will never publish without your consent).
- Whether you intend to disclose publicly, and your preferred timeline.
You do not need a finished PoC to report — early heads-up on a suspected issue is welcome.

We follow a coordinated disclosure model. Once a fix is ready we will:
- Cut a patch release on every supported minor.
- Publish a GitHub Security Advisory with credit to you (unless you prefer to remain anonymous).
- Request a CVE via GitHub's CNA.
- Note the fix in
CHANGELOG.mdunder a### Securityheading, referencing the CVE.
If we do not respond within the window above, please escalate by replying to your original report — the inbox is monitored personally.

These are deployment concerns, not library bugs, but they materially affect your production posture:
- Put the dashboard behind your existing auth proxy (OIDC, mTLS, internal-only ingress). The built-in Basic Auth is a defence-in-depth control, not a primary perimeter.
- Set a strong
webhookSecretand rotate it viaIFlowRunControlStore— do not commit it to source. - Use the SQL Server / PostgreSQL persistence with least-privilege credentials — the engine only needs
SELECT/INSERT/UPDATE/DELETEon theFlow*tables, plusCREATE TABLEonce during migrator startup. - Enable TLS on every database connection string and Service Bus namespace.
- Pin the Hangfire dashboard behind separate auth —
app.UseHangfireDashboard("/hangfire", new DashboardOptions { Authorization = ... }). - Subscribe to this repo's Security advisories via the Watch → Custom → Security alerts dropdown so you get notified the moment a CVE is published.
